The current signalling framework for Digital Video Broadcasting (DVB) systems is based on MPEG-2 encoded Program Specific Information and System Information (PSI/SI) Tables that rely on the Transport Stream (TS). It is expected that in time, this architecture will be replaced by one based on the Generic Stream Encapsulation (GSE) protocol, paving the way for the convergence of DVB-S2 broadcast transmission...

This paper presents a revision of the status of current standards dedicated to mobile services systems, using combined satellite and terrestrial components transmission. The objective is the analysis of a hybrid system compatible with DVB-SH and SDR technologies, taking as a basis the work and studies performed in MOVISAT project.
This paper presents the IPv6/IPv4 IPTV and Multiconference Unit trials performed within the frame of SATSIX, an EC funded IST FP6 project that deals with innovative techniques over transparent and meshed regenerative satellite networks.
